KUKA KR40 PA
Robot details
The KUKA KR 40 PA is a 4‑axis industrial palletizing robot specifically designed for high‑speed palletizing and depalletizing applications in logistics, packaging, and production environments.
With a payload capacity of 40 kg and a palletizing‑optimized working envelope, the KR 40 PA delivers fast cycle times, high repeatability, and efficient vertical motion, making it ideal for handling boxes, bags, trays, and packaged products at the end of production lines.
The robot features a simplified 4‑axis kinematic structure, optimized for palletizing patterns and vertical movements, resulting in lower inertia, higher speed, and reduced maintenance requirements compared to standard 6‑axis robots.
The system is powered by the KUKA KR C5 controller, ensuring precise motion control, modern connectivity, and seamless integration into automated palletizing cells.
Palletizing Motion Concept and Performance
The KUKA KR 40 PA is engineered for maximum throughput and efficiency in palletizing operations.
Key performance characteristics include:
- High‑speed vertical and rotational movements
- Optimized palletizing kinematics
- Smooth and repeatable stacking patterns
- Reduced cycle times per layer
- Excellent stability during high‑speed operation
The 4‑axis design simplifies programming and enhances reliability in continuous palletizing cycles.
